The effects of cortisol hormone generally include anti-inflammatory, anti-shock, anti-rheumatism, as well as anti-anaphylaxis.
Cortisol hormone is a glucocorticoid hormone secreted by the adrenal cortex. Cortisol hormone can maintain the balance and stability of the body’s physiological functions, and plays a very important role in the metabolism of proteins, fats and sugars. When a stress reaction occurs, the body can make cortisol rapidly secreted into the blood to maintain the stability of blood glucose and blood pressure.
Cortisol hormone can also control inflammation, when the body has severe infection, shock, inflammation, adrenal cortical hormone secretion, including cortisol secretion, can play a good role in the body’s anti-inflammatory, anti-shock.
After the cortisol hormone is elevated, there are side effects on the body, easily cause high blood pressure, high blood sugar, at the same time easy to cause stress ulcers, osteoporosis, but also can appear mental symptoms, commonly seen in Cushing’s syndrome, can cause full moon face, buffalo back, and high cholesterol anemia and other symptoms.
